What is Needed to Grow a Plant

Secure

Student is able to identify all elements necessary to successfully grow a bean plant:
- seed
- water
- sun
Developing

Student is able to identify most elements necessary to successfully grow a bean plant (2).
Beginning

Student is able to identify few elements necessary to successfully grow a bean plant (0-1).
Parts of a Plant

Secure

Student is able to identify all parts of a plant:
- seed
- roots
- stem
- leaves
Developing

Student is able to identify most parts of a plant (2-3).
Beginning

Student is able to identify few parts of a plant (0-2).
Why We Need Plants

Secure

Student is able to identify all reasons why plants are necessary to the environment:
- provide food/medicine
- provide fresh air
- provide shelter
Developing

Student is able to identify most reasons why plants are necessary to the environment (2).
Beginning

Student is able to identify few reasons why plants are necessary to the environment (0-1).
